Introduction
Royal Marines Bandsman Ken McDonald served aboard HMS Gloucester
aiding the evacuation of Allied troops from Crete in May 1941. The
Germans took McDonald prisoner following an airborne and sea attack, sinking many of the vessels including HMS Gloucester.
McDonald spent the remainder of the war as a prisoner of war in various
camps in Greece and the German Reich.
